A hand where you have 4 of the 5 cards needed to make a
straight, but your 4 cards are not "connected" or in sequential order, so you need a single card in the middle of your
straight to
complete the
straight. This type of hand is also known as an "inside
straight draw" or a "belly-buster
straight draw".
Example: You are holding 5 6, and the board shows 7, 9, 10. At that moment, you have a gut shot, only the 8 will make your straight.
